Competitive Advantages

Yakima County’s primary operating cost factors (labor, electricity, real estate, etc.) are far below the national average, and nearly 20 percent lower than that of larger regions like Seattle.
The region enjoys a strong multi-modal transportation network, including abundant sites with highway frontage or proximity, many served by rail.  Paired with the Yakima Valley’s proximity of Portland and Seattle and their higher value-added industrial manufacturers, this represents a significant advantage for industrial machinery and supply companies
The city of Yakima (and surrounding municipalities) enjoy some of the lowest local tax rates in Washington state.  These low rates are enhanced by tax incentives that can further reduce a machinery or supply manufacturer’s sales taxes or business and occupation taxes.

Industrial Machinery Companies

COMPANY NAME LOCATION PRODUCT
Irwin Research & Development Yakima Machinery for Foam Packaging
Thermoforming Systems, LLC Union Gap Machinery for Foam Packaging
Van Doren Wenatchee Machinery for Fruit Sorting
Koch Manufacturing Sunnyside Packaging Machinery
Kwik-Lok Yakima Packaging Machinery
Marq Packaging Yakima Packaging Machinery
Sims Manufacturing Yakima Packaging Machinery

Wage & Employment Data

OCCUPATION MEDIAN HOURLY ANNUAL AVERAGE
Industrial Production Manager 70 $44.32
First Line Supervisors – Production 330 $25.15
Human Resource Manager 150 $24.55
Bookkeeping, Accounting, Auditing 1,270 $17.44
Office Clerk, General 1,560 $13.62
Machinist 100 $17.68
Structural Metal Fabricators/Fitters 130 $18.46
Welders/Cutters/Solderers 140 $16.99
Computer-Controlled Machine Tool Operators N/A $18.59
Cutting/Punching Press Machine Operators N/A $14.19
Coating/Painting/Sprayers Machine Setters 50 $12.95
Industrial Machinery Mechanics 280 $20.46
Helpers – Production 360 $11.49
Source: Bureau of Labor Statistics, May 2010
